** Shares of vaccine makers fall after President Donald Trump's pick for U.S. health secretary, Robert F. Kennedy Jr., moved closer to the job following a favorable vote by a U.S. Senate panel
** Kennedy, who founded the anti-vaccine group Children's Health Defense, has long sown doubts about the safety and efficacy of vaccines
** Shares of Pfizer PFE.N fall 1.5%, Moderna MRNA.O fall 4.2%, U.S.-listed shares of BioNTech 22UAy.DE down 2.5% and Novavax NVAX.O down 2.3%
** Earlier on Tuesday, Pfizer shares were up 2% in pre-market trading on better-than-expected quarterly results
** Up to the last close, PFE down 2.7%, MRNA down 62.5% in the last 12 months
